Getting Started: Registration and Verification

First-time users of Sky Bet must create an account using a valid Irish email address and a secure password. The registration page asks for basic details – name, date of birth, and an address in the Republic of Ireland – all of which are checked against the Central Licensing Register. After you hit “Submit”, an email with a verification link lands in your inbox; clicking it activates the account and prompts the next step.

The verification (or KYC) process is where you upload a photo ID, a proof‑of‑address document such as a utility bill, and occasionally a recent bank statement. This extra layer protects you from fraud and satisfies the Irish Revenue and gambling regulator. Once approved, the account is marked “Verified”, and you can start making sky bet transfers without hitting daily limits.

Depositing Funds: Payment Methods and Security

Sky Bet supports a range of deposit options that are popular with Irish punters – credit/debit cards (Visa, Mastercard), e‑wallets (PayPal, Skrill, Neteller), and direct bank transfers via Faster Payments. Each method has its own speed and fee structure, and all are processed over encrypted SSL connections that meet PCI‑DSS standards. Because the platform holds a gambling licence from the UK Gambling Commission, it must also comply with the Irish National Betting Office’s security requirements.

Below is a quick reference for the most common ways to fund your Sky Bet account.

Payment Method Deposit Speed Withdrawal Speed Fees
Visa / Mastercard Instant 2–3 days No fee for deposits, £2‑£5 for withdrawals
PayPal Instant Same‑day No fee for either direction
Skrill / Neteller Instant 1–2 days No fee for deposits, £3‑£6 for withdrawals
Bank Transfer (Faster Payments) Up to 30 minutes 2–5 days No fee for deposits, £5‑£10 for withdrawals

Withdrawing Winnings: Withdrawal Speed and Options

When you’re ready to cash out, the same payment methods used for deposits can be chosen for withdrawals, though some e‑wallets may be faster than cards. After you request a withdrawal, Sky Bet runs a security check that can take up to 24 hours; once approved, the funds are sent to your chosen account. The average withdrawal speed for PayPal is same‑day, while bank transfers usually land in your account within 2–3 business days.

It’s worth noting that large withdrawals may trigger an additional verification step – you might be asked to submit a recent bank statement or a selfie holding your ID. This is a standard anti‑money‑laundering measure and protects both you and the operator from fraud.
